The Role of Responsible Gambling Tools
A reputable betting platform prioritizes the well-being of its users by providing a suite of responsible gambling tools. These tools may include de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and time limits. Implementing these safeguards demonstrates a commitment to ethical practices and helps to prevent problem gambling. Furthermore, providing access to resources and support organizations for those struggling with gambling addiction is a crucial step in promoting responsible betting behavior. These elements signal a platform's dedication to fostering a safe and sustainable gambling environment. A transparent approach to terms and conditions, alongside readily available customer support, reinforces this commitment.
- Deposit Limits: Set daily, weekly, or monthly limits on the amount of money deposited.
- Loss Limits: Define a maximum amount of money that can be lost within a specific timeframe.
- Self-Exclusion: Temporarily or permanently block access to the platform.
- Time Limits: Restrict the amount of time spent on the platform.
- Reality Checks: Receive periodic notifications informing you of how long you’ve been playing and how much you’ve wagered.
Effectively utilizing these tools is a crucial component of responsible gaming. They allow users to maintain control over their betting activity and prevent potential financial hardship. A platform that actively promotes these features demonstrates a genuine concern for its users’ well-being.
Security and Trust: The Foundation of a Reliable Platform
In the realm of online betting, security is paramount. Bettors are entrusting platforms with their personal and financial information, making robust security measures absolutely essential. The use of industry-standard enc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), is a fundamental requirement. Furthermore, platforms should adhere to strict data privacy regulations, ensuring that user information is protected from unauthorized access and misuse. Licensing and regulation by reputable gaming authorities provide an additional layer of security and accountability. These authorities conduct regular audits to ensure that platforms are operating fairly and transparently. A platform’s reputation is built on trust, and a demonstrable commitment to security is the cornerstone of that trust. Continuous investment in security infrastructure is vital to stay ahead of evolving threats.
